Samuel Danielsson

Birth01 Oct 1757 - Bjärten, Västerbotten, Sverige
Death1838 - Bjurholm, Västerbotten, Sverige
MotherAnna Samuelsdotter
FatherDaniel Eriksson

Born in Bjärten, Västerbotten, Sverige on 01 Oct 1757 to Daniel Eriksson and Anna Samuelsdotter. Samuel Danielsson married Ulrika Larsdotter and had 9 children. He passed away on 1838 in Bjurholm, Västerbotten, Sverige.
